  • The One With the One of a Kind GM's
    Join us for a fascinating conversation with Elaine Beckett, General Manager of Trackdown Studios - the largest scoring stage in the Southern Hemisphere. Elaine shares her 21-year journey from work experience student to industry leader, and what it takes to manage one of Australia’s most iconic creative spaces.In this episode, Elaine talks about wearing many hats - score coordinator, producer, problem-solver—and what it’s like to support projects from Happy Feet to major Hollywood films. She reveals how Trackdown evolved from a 1970s rehearsal room to a world-class facility used by global productions, and why collaboration is at the heart of every great soundtrack.We dive into the human side of film scoring - the orchestras, composers, and behind-the-scenes teams that bring stories to life - and how music shapes emotion and memory on screen.   • The One With Australia's Oscar's Contender
    Join us for an inspiring conversation with Gabrielle Brady, a visionary filmmaker, known for her unique approach to storytelling. Gabrielle shares her journey from acting in Sydney to studying film in Cuba, now based in Berlin and how her experiences have shaped her career in documentary and hybrid filmmaking. Discover her insights on maintaining creative integrity, the challenges of funding, and the importance of collaboration in the film industry.   • Bonus Episode: Launchpad - Ray Taylor
    In this Launchpad episode of the Undertow Content podcast, we meet filmmaker Ray Taylor, a passionate director dedicated to authentic, character-driven stories that normalise LGBTQ+ and disabled communities without centring trauma.Ray shares his journey from theatre to film, creating 12 short films in 12 months during COVID, and becoming the only Academy Gold Rising intern to complete both the partner and production tracks. About CUT! The Podcast

Working in entertainment can sometimes feel like a minefield. Whether you’re an actor, producer, director, editor or cameraman, it’s hard to know where to start or who to talk to. And even if you do, it’s practically impossible to get past the gatekeepers.Undertow Content’s Amanda Browne and Nell Nakkan want to change that. They’re on a mission to build a supportive community that shares information, and have found experts from all areas of the industry keen to share their experiences and knowledge.
